Mastering the Art of the Crosswalk: Timing and Prediction

Successfully navigating the chaotic environment of the game demands more than just quick reflexes; it requires a strategic approach to timing and prediction. Observing the patterns of the oncoming traffic is crucial. Players should resist the urge to rush across the road impulsively and instead focus on identifying gaps in the flow of vehicles. Understanding the speed and trajectory of each car allows for more accurate estimations of when to initiate a crossing. A skilled player doesn't just react to the cars that are immediately in front of them, but anticipates the arrival of those further down the road, adjusting their timing accordingly. It's a mental exercise in spatial awareness and risk assessment.

Different types of vehicles may also present unique challenges. Larger trucks and buses generally move slower but occupy more space, requiring a wider gap to safely pass. Faster cars, while smaller, demand quicker reactions. Learning to differentiate these characteristics and adjust strategies accordingly is key to consistently successful crossings. Furthermore, paying attention to the background can reveal visual cues indicating upcoming traffic formations. A subtle shift in the road's perspective can hint at an approaching wave of vehicles, allowing players to prepare for a more challenging crossing. This is not just a game of reflexes, but one of observation and calculated risk.

Mobile Gaming and the Rise of Hyper-Casual Titles

The game's simplicity makes it particularly well-suited for mobile gaming platforms. Its straightforward mechanics require minimal input, making it ideal for touch screen controls. The short, fast-paced gameplay sessions are perfect for on-the-go entertainment. In recent years, the game has seen a resurgence in popularity as part of the growing hyper-casual gaming market. Hyper-casual games are characterized by their simple mechanics, minimalist design, and addictive gameplay loops. They are often free-to-play and rely on advertising for revenue.

The success of chickenroad in the hyper-casual market demonstrates the enduring appeal of simple, accessible games.
